Secretary Blinken’s Call with United Arab Emirates President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an

The following is attributable to Spokesperson Ned Price:

Secretary of State Antony J. Blinken spoke today with UAE President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an. The Secretary reaffirmed the strong U.S.-UAE partnership and reviewed ways to broaden and deepen our wide-ranging cooperation, including our shared commitment to peace in Yemen. They spoke about recent regional developments, such as the need for Israelis and Palestinians to urgently take steps to prevent further escalation of violence and restore calm. Secretary Blinken expressed gratitude for the UAE’s hosting of the Negev Forum Working Groups in Abu Dhabi on January 9-10, as well as the UAE’s climate cooperation and leadership ahead of COP28.
